Garnish with lemon wedges and serve ramekins of the Oregano and Lemon Pesto Butter along with for dipping. 1/4 cup pumpkin seeds2 little cloves garlicCoarse salt and split black pepper1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ese1/4 cup fresh oregano leaves, coarsely chopped1/2 cup packed fresh basil leaves2 teaspoons honeyZest and juice of 1 lemon1/2 cup olive oil1/2 cup saltless butter, melted over low heat In a dry small frying pan, toast the pumpkin seeds over medium-low heat, tossing regularly, until lightly golden and extremely fragrant, about 5 minutes.

In a food processor, pulse the pumpkin seeds, garlic, and a generous pinch each of salt and pepper up until the seeds are broken down. Add the parmesan, oregano, basil, honey, and lemon enthusiasm and juice and pulse until thoroughly combined. With the motor running, stream in the olive oil a bit at a time until the pesto is velvety.

Season to taste with extra salt and pepper if needed. Makes about 2 cups., Mandolin Chef Sean Fowler show us that greens take well to the grill to.
